Side by side comparison of the JDM optional frameless mirror. The one really thing about it is the 2 pivots that would let the mirror sit much higher or lower. I basically have it sitting at it's max height and it gives me about 1-2 inches more of viewing space

Small update/purchase. I accidentally chipped my door in my garage, so I went ahead and bought the Dr Colorchip kit and things came out better then excepted. There still is a very small indent but the actual paint is sealed up and it the color matching is good. Better then my OEM Honda touch up paint in the past at least.
